Mobius Foundation to hold International Conference to promote sustainable practices

New Dehli: In a bid to promote sustainable practices, Mobius Foundation will hold a two-day International Conference on Sustainability Education (ICSE) in New Delhi.

The Conference will kick off on September 19, under the theme “Educating for Climate Action and Sustainability, to address urgent challenges of climate change and to promote best sustainable practices.

Pradip Burman, Chairman, of Mobius Foundation, said, “Sustainability education stands as a beacon of hope, equipping generations with the wisdom and tools to navigate the challenges of our time.

“The 5th ICSE provides a unique forum to forge partnerships, inspire novel initiatives, and harness the collective power of education for tangible, positive change. As we embark on this journey towards ‘Educating for Climate Action and Sustainability,’ let us remember that through education, we empower ourselves to be stewards of the environment, paving the way for a harmonious and sustainable future” he added.

The theme of this year’s conference is a response to the critical need for concerted efforts to combat climate change and promote sustainable practices.

The conference aims to inspire, educate, and empower participants to drive positive change in their communities and beyond, aligning with the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) and global initiatives for a better future.

The two-day conference will unfold through hybrid sessions, blending the physical participation of around 300 attendees with a global virtual presence.

“The program will encompass plenary sessions, workshops, panel discussions, and presentations, creating an immersive experience aimed at inspiring transformative action,” it said.

“The 5th edition of ICSE is poised to bring together minds from across the globe to engage in constructive discussions and collaborative efforts towards addressing the issues related to climate change,” said the statement.

The 4th edition of ICSE in 2022, facilitated robust connections and partnerships, amplifying the impact of educators committed to sustainability. The virtual 2nd and 3rd editions addressed contemporary sustainability education issues, such as policies, ecosystem restoration, and climate literacy.
